Abstract:
The changing economic climate of China places challenges on the development of the urban fringe. Planners must balance China's desire for increased industrial growth with the political goals of Chinese cities to maintain self-sufficient agriculture.
Abstract:
Most developing countries are undergoing major demographic transitions, characterized by rapid population growth and massive urban-bound movement. Projects and programs designed by planners at all levels are affected by demographic change, and thus an understanding of the complex relationship between demographics and development can provide planners with a framework for developing projects.
